Question

which best describes the processes of mitosis and meiosis?
cells in mitosis go through the pmat stages twice to produce diploid cells while cells in meiosis go through pmat stages once to produce haploid cells.
cells in mitosis and meiosis go through the pmat stages twice to produce haploid cells.
cells in mitosis go through the pmat stages once to produce diploid cells while cells in meiosis go through pmat stages twice to produce haploid cells.
cells in mitosis and meiosis go through the pmat stages once to produce diploid cells

Explanation:

Brief Explanations
  • Mitosis is a single - cycle process (goes through PMAT stages once). The parent cell is diploid (\(2n\)), and the daughter cells produced are also diploid (\(2n\)). It is mainly for growth, repair, and asexual reproduction.
  • Meiosis has two cycles (goes through PMAT stages twice). The starting cell is diploid (\(2n\)), and after meiosis I (reductional division) and meiosis II (equational division), the resulting cells are haploid (\(n\)). It is for sexual reproduction to produce gametes.

Answer:

Cells in mitosis go through the PMAT stages once to produce diploid cells while cells in meiosis go through PMAT stages twice to produce haploid cells.
